Christina Hendricks & Geoffrey Arend

Christina & Geoffrey's First Dance

Mad Men beauty Christina Hendricks met actor Geoffrey Arend through a mutual friend in 2006. In Style Magazine reported that after Christina fell in love with the vintage chandeliers at their fave restaurant Il Buco’s in New York City, Geoffrey convinced the owner to sell him one! He hung the piece in their dining room and proposed right underneath it!

The two married on October 11, 2009 in NYC (their reception was at Il Buco’s!) with 70 of their closet friends and family in attendance. The wedding party wore vintage dress with flowers designed by Saipua.

Brooklyn Decker & Andy Roddick

A year ago today,  tennis player Andy Roddick and supermodel Brooklyn Decker tied the knot.

They didn’t meet in the traditional sense. Roddick was so intrigued with Decker’s swimsuit pictures in Sports Illustrated that he asked his agent to look for some sort of phone number to get in contact with her. This was back in 2007, and they have been inseparable ever since.

The couple married at Roddick’s home in Austin, Texas at twilight in a small candlelit ceremony before friends and family. Guests included tennis greats Billie Jean King, Andre Agassi and Steffi Graf, as well as Sir Elton John who provided a musical performance.

Though it had rained all day, it’s fairly certain the gloomy weather didn’t dampen the spirits of anyone at the wedding. In fact, spirits were so high that the festivities continued onto the next day. The couple, along with 250 guests, continued to celebrate their union at a restaurant in downtown Austin called Stubb’s Bar-B-Que with plenty of food and music.

Zsa Zsa Gabor & Felipe De Alba

Although Hungarian actress and socialite, Zsa Zsa Gabor, married her beau, Mexican attorney/actor Felipe De Alba, on April 13, 1983, today is a significant day in wedding history because it was one day later that their marriage ended.

Even though she hasn’t had a ton of luck in marriage, this woman is certainly a fan of it considering she’s been married nine times.

“To be loved is a strength, to love is a weakness,” Gabor famously said. With an attitude like that, it’s no wonder that so many of her marriages didn’t last.

This particular union was interesting because when she tied the knot with De Alba near Puerta Vallerta, Mexico, she was not yet divorced from her previous husband. That’s why 28 years ago today the union was considered invalid.

Hector Elizondo & Carolee Campbell

A big congrats to Hector Elizondo & Carolee Campbell as they celebrate their 42st wedding anniversary.

This is one very interesting couple. They’re both accomplished stage and screen actors with impressive awards, but check out their other talents and achievements!

Elizondo is a musician, singer, dancer and an athlete. (That’s right. Playing baseball in high school, he was even scouted by the New York (now San Francisco) Giants & Pittsburgh Pirates.) Campbell is an accomplished photographer and celebrated illustrator and publisher who in 1984 founded Ninja Press, which creates and makes books by hand.
